  • Position: full sun or partial shade
  • Soil: moderately fertile, moist but well drained soil
  • Rate of growth: average
  • Flowering period: July to September
  • Hardiness: fully hardy


This herbaceous clematis forms an open bush, that looks wonderful when allowed to drift through the mixed or herbaceous border. For several weeks from midsummer, Clematis 'New Love' is covered with deliciously scented, hyacinth-like, lavender-blue flowers, which really stand out against the backdrop of the lobed green leaves.


  • Garden care:
    Clematis are happiest when their roots are kept cool and moist, so try to plant them where that the base of the plants will be lightly shaded by other, lower-growing species. Otherwise, use a clematis root protector, or top-dress the rootball (avoiding the immediate crown), with a generous layer of shingle or pebbles.

    This clematis is herbaceous and will die back during the winter - remove spent stems and foliage to the ground in February, and apply a thick layer of mulch to suppress weeds, feed the soil, and keep the root area moist and cool for the growing season ahead.

    Use twiggy prunings, ring stakes or bamboo canes to provide support.
